On the Mountain:
Walker - At his best at the most crucial times
McDonald -Golden Spikes, No. 1 pick
Furniss - Steady Eddy,103 RBIs single season
Belle - Skip says he was the best. Saw him hit an oppo in the Superdome (against Miami) that had Florida State team hooting and hollering, including Deion Sanders
My personal favorite players:
Armando Rios - BIG attitude. Tough, and clutch
Brandon Larson -greatest single season in LSU history
Brad Hawpe - Hit huge home runs in CWS in the clutch
Gary Hymel - Gorilla ball and toughness personified
Mike Koerner - honorable mention. Came up huge in 1997 CWS
